Merchants Commercial Bank in collaboration with the V.I. Small Business Development Center, will host an informational workshop on the Employee Retention Tax Credit (ERTC) program on Dec. 6, the bank made known via release Wednesday.

The workshop will feature presentations by The Strategy Group and OBI CAI Management Consulting Solutions focused on providing businesses with the tools to process a claim under the ERTC program. 

The ERTC is a refundable credit that businesses throughout the territory can claim on qualified wages, including certain health insurance costs, paid to employees after March 12, 2020, through the end of the program – regardless of whether the business participated in the SBA Paycheck Protection Program (PPP).
